This method incorporates a h2o sample respond with a mix of sulfuric acid get more info and potassium dichromate in the sealed container then digested for two hours at 150oC. The sample is then read in a spectrophotometer to determine the outcome. The Chemical Oxygen Demand (COD) is usually a measure for the quantity of oxygen eaten in the course of the oxidation of organic and natural matter, which provides a transparent indicator for the quality of a water supply, it is actually of course considered one of The most crucial parameters in (waste) drinking water Investigation. As dichromate ion oxidizes organic subject in the sample, it is lowered to chromic ion, which happens to be reflected by a modify in shade from orange or yellow to environmentally friendly. The sample is then examine in a photometer or spectrophotometer to evaluate the adjust in coloration.
